Content
- High Load Systems
- Which technologies do we apply?
- Big Data’s role in customer-centric engagement: what is it and how it may work
- Get High-Level solution architecture diagram for FREE
- How load balancing operates
- What Is A Highload Project?
- The business task is to increase conversion from content display.
- Find Our Projects Here
In addition, we are developing applications that involve the simultaneous processing of large amounts of data. Our developers of high-load systems implement scalable, reliable, and efficient applications to use. Most mobile applications depend on back-end infrastructure for their success. They are coded using programming languages and may only depend on fundamental architecture solutions and best practices. They cannot manage high user requests and provide high data processing rates without a high load system.
Systems optimization of the apps will be easy, and the business can handle huge user traffic levels. However, if the project didn’t use a high-load system, the server-side systems will become overloaded. When server-side systems are overwhelmed, this will result in a crash, and multiple problems will escalate. Applications that should handle high load require a different development approach than software that is not meant to deal with such pressure. The optimization and careful architecture development are necessary for creating reliable high-load solutions. We can develop for you a high-load application that will handle the pressure of thousands of requests with ease.
As previously mentioned, the foundation of any web application project is its architecture. A high load system enables the app to meet basic requirements that are within the fault tolerance. You can read more information online to get a full understanding. When designing such projects, you need to understand that there are no standard solutions that would be suitable for any high-load system.
Below are a number of challenges that arise for the engineering team and the solution. From the engineering perspective, a lack of resources causes performance degradation. Development of High-Load Systems As you probably noted, all the listed definitions and tons of others did not satisfy me completely.
High Load Systems
Jenney stated in 1883, “ we are building to a height to rival the Tower of Babel. ” In the 1890s, “ most European cities like London, Paris, and Rome rejected tall buildings in their historical city centers meanwhile opting for height control regulations to maintain their low skylines. Today, however, we witness Paris and London giving away their horizontality in favor of the vertical scale. The strategy for load testing considers all potential pitfalls and challenges that can create bottlenecks or hinder performance in a software application. A thorough strategy acknowledges every feature, functionality, and component of the application in order to build a comprehensive plan to design a realistic workload and gauge performance. High load projects developed by Geniusee specialists on average withstand user traffic, exceeding the planned indicators by 2–3 times or more!
On the other hand, some use high-load architecture to allow for the possibility of scaling up when demand grows. A high load project is a project that’s built with a scalable design. Its framework allows more users to join and more features to be added as the business grows. If you are running a project, for example, a marketing campaign, it should be easy to increase the number of users and integrate new features. Our client is the largest Ukrainian telecom operator, providing communications and data services based on a broad range of mobile and fixed-line technologies. Couldn’t have made a better decision than deciding to work with DigitalMara.
Studies are often required to ensure that pedestrian wind comfort and wind danger concerns are addressed. In order to allow less wind exposure, to transmit more daylight to the ground and to appear more slender, many high-rises have a design with setbacks. The terms performance testing, load testing, and stress testing are sometimes used interchangeably when in reality they differ greatly from one another. Software applications and systems are information-intensive and are ultimately created to provide a solution to a problem.
As if that’s not enough, you could lose your valuable clients. Over 90% of a project’s success is pre-determined by its architecture. N-iX extended teams build high-load systems and applications for global companies.
Known as hotel-residences, this type of occupancy is later addressed in mixed-use buildings. Steel-Framed Core Construction – These structures are built of lightweight steel or reinforced concrete frames, with exterior all-glass curtain walls. As Salvadori stated, “The so-called curtain walls of our highrise buildings consist of thin, vertical metal struts or mullions, which encase the large glass panels constituting most of the wall surface.
Which technologies do we apply?
To prevent this from happening, platforms should be built using a high-load architecture. Intellias has become an integral component of the company’s IT operations and has set the stage for a long-term partnership. Owning full responsibility for the client’s back-office high-load systems, we derive valuable insights into the company’s business context and needs. Thus, we can see potential challenges and solve them with tailored solutions by drawing on our deep technical expertise in developing telecom software.
When one of the components fails or cannot handle the requests, the server becomes overloaded. When planning, take one step behind and identify which part of the system can bring issues under load. If you think you will have a problem in the database, select a highly scalable prior to doing the project. You may opt to take several databases, one designed for writes and the other for reads .
Big Data’s role in customer-centric engagement: what is it and how it may work
Regarding mobile apps development, back-end infrastructure consists of 95% of the entire project success. Most apps are developed through basic best practices and architecture solutions or employing programming languages. With the assistance of automated garbage collection programs, manually delete items from a user’s system high-load management systems development memory is no longer needed. This is very vital when developing a Java high load app solutions that deal with large data. Using Java apps development, complicated tasks are quickly resolved using multiple processor threads. In the future, it is quite difficult to identify the audience size who will be using your software.
Situation assessment in air combat considering incomplete frame of … – Nature.com
Situation assessment in air combat considering incomplete frame of ….
Posted: Sat, 31 Dec 2022 14:44:51 GMT [source]
When your resource is limited, you can lose your audience due to the inability to satisfy all their needs. High-load applications grow along with the number of your users. In the business environment, an opinion has formed that technology startups can replace financial institutions.
Get High-Level solution architecture diagram for FREE
This affects the user experience and their satisfaction with your service. High-load web applications make it possible to guarantee successful data processing of requests even if one of the servers fails. The highest demand will be for universal tools able to test both mobile and web applications. And since it’s cumbersome to organize load testing via real devices, the popularity of cloud load testing tools will also grow. The COVID-19 pandemic brought even more users and businesses to the Internet. Because of that the load on popular web resources is expected to continue growing.
- But there’s a problem with them – we still have no clear definition of the term.
- ” In the 1890s, “ most European cities like London, Paris, and Rome rejected tall buildings in their historical city centers meanwhile opting for height control regulations to maintain their low skylines.
- It generates AI driven proactive next-best-response suggestions to live agents based on previous conversations.
- Customers end up abandoning whatever services are being provided.
- Our developers of high-load systems implement scalable, reliable, and efficient applications to use.
- With high load systems there is no need to worry about possible data loss or damages that can cause data leaks.
Whatever your project size is, in some instances, you may be required to scale up. For instance, data can be acquired from a server that’s overwhelmed to be redistributed to other available servers. To process a larger load, data collection and analysis systems are being designed. If a business makes money on https://globalcloudteam.com/ the Internet, it is always — in one way or another — collecting and analyzing data, for example, types of products that users look at or skip. Or who is watching a video together, with the information about the type of device and the time of day. Such data is needed to understand how to develop one’s product.
How load balancing operates
Reporting infrastructure problems is also the role of monitoring. This helps experts to know when a metric rises above crucial levels. You should also note that the total number of users an app attracts may vary. Thus, each app should be assayed exclusively to identify its load status. The security of the web service requires the maximum level of protection against data leakage into open access.
Highly loaded systems face problems with the operation of physical and network nodes all the time. Developers embody the architecture and implementation of the project so that minor failures do not entail problems in the operation of the software solution. Processing centers and systems must be resistant to failures in the operation and maintenance of hard drives, power supply, etc.
What Is A Highload Project?
DuPont™ Highload™ XPS Insulation is designed to stand up to the demands of airport runways, bridge abutments, ice rinks, and more. To keep API request times down at high load I might need more servers, or some type of in memory cache like redis. This system won’t present operational challenges at first, and i won’t even know where to optimize for load until it starts to happen.
The business task is to increase conversion from content display.
We design and build reliable, efficient, and scalable software. When developing high load fintech applications, the Geniusee team is guided by several principles. High-load applications that successfully tackle various performance challenges. We design system architectures that maintain high computing speeds and uninterrupted services with short response times. Our experts use load balancing and cloud computing capacities for critical user operations and real-time data processing. One of the most important stages for developing high load applications because, without proper QA, the main functions and capabilities of the application may suffer.
If an application needs to handle many users and volumes of data that are constantly growing, one server is not enough. The largest high load applications run on hundreds of physical servers. Of course, not every fintech business needs to develop high-load applications. So, for example, if you have a small coverage of the territory and target audience , and your audience is several thousand people, you do not need to invest in such development.